"Intermediate Dynamics" by R.A. Howland is a mathematics book and learning resource focused on Dynamics. Best for teachers, students, and readers looking for stronger mathematical understanding.

Complete, rigorous review of Linear Algebra, from Vector Spaces to Normal Forms Emphasis on more classical Newtonian treatment (favored by Engineers) of rigid bodies, and more modern in greater reliance on Linear Algebra to get inertia matrix and deal with machines Develops Analytical Dynamics to allow the introduction of friction

Best For: Students and professionals in engineering and applied mathematics focusing on dynamics and mechanical systems.
Focus: A rigorous review of linear algebra applied to classical Newtonian dynamics and analytical dynamics, emphasizing rigid body mechanics and inertia matrices.
Covers: Vector spaces, normal forms, Newtonian treatment of rigid bodies, inertia matrix computation, and introduction of friction in analytical dynamics.
Why It Matters: Provides a solid mathematical foundation for understanding and analyzing mechanical systems using both classical and modern linear algebraic methods, important for engineering applications.
